Output 95fc6f3f9dc44d8383167a4ce097035340b1b1c40f78cee0857c99b0f94de0fe:1

value
924439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2094446c34788d7c2787de029b28d7a9d7d193e9 OP_EQUAL
address
34fHAUQLczKHGYPe2Mf7b57UpjaSeFeVSN
transaction
95fc6f3f9dc44d8383167a4ce097035340b1b1c40f78cee0857c99b0f94de0fe
confirmations
349829
spent
true